His son Andreas Christian was born in 1888 and died in 1975. ...There were two Andreas Christian Romer, father and son. The father was also referred to as Christian. He was born 1831 in Hamburg, Germany and came to Australia in 1854. He married Mary Louisa Treloar. His son Andreas Christian was born in 1888 and died in 1975. He was married to Margaret Aubrey in 1911. If this photo was taken in 1890 it must have been taken by Andreas Snr.Bendigo Advertiser '' the way we were'' from 2002. Home sweet home: this photo was produced from a glass slide taken by Andreas Christian Romer who resided at 55 Wade Street, Golden Square. It is believed to be dated about 1890. In this photo, Occupational Therapist Andrea Renton, addresses the audience from the stage during the panel discussion....[handwritten in pencil] Mrs. Andrea Renton a physiotherapist [handwritten in light blue ink] Page 4...Andrea Renton a physiotherapist [handwritten in light blue ink] Page 4 B&W photo of a woman speaking into a microphone on a stand. ...On Friday the 26th and Saturday the 27th of May, 1978, an art and craft exhibition was held as a fundraising event in support of the Rheumatism and Arthritis Association of Victoria (RAAV). Titled, "Living with Arthritis - Aids to Daily Living", the exhibition was held at St Andrew's Parish Hall in Brighton. A second "Living with Arthritis" exhibition was held two months later in Footscray. Henceforth, the respective events were commonly referred to as "the Brighton exhibition" and "the Footscray exhibition". A fashion parade and panel discussion were also held as part of the two-day event. One of 16 colour photos of Friends of the Park float for the February 1989 Port Melbourne Festival: Nellie Thackruh, Jan Fly and Andrea Ellis in background, finishing preparations in Raglan Street...On arrival at Murphy's Reserve all floats were put out of sight, and few saw the results of their efforts. celebrations fetes and exhibitions public action campaigns jan fly andrea ellis nellie thackruh friends of the park port melbourne festival One of 16 colour photos of Friends of the Park float for the February 1989 Port Melbourne Festival: Nellie Thackruh, Jan Fly and Andrea Ellis in background, finishing preparations in Raglan Street Photograph Friends of the Park float, Port Melbourne Festival Pat Grainger ...This float was created by members of Friends of the Park, a group formed in 1987 against government proposals to turn the railway and reservation into a grand boulevard to service the proposed Sandridge City 'bayside' development. Members worked for months to make the decorations, added to a trailer. During the festival procession sausages were BBQ'd on the trailer and handed out to the crowd. Article by Andrea Witt '' History recognised'' about Edith Lunn receiving an Order of Australia medal for her contribution to the recording of local history. ...Edith Marie Bishop was born 27/7/1907 in Bendigo. In 1937 she married Jim Checcucci who died in 1964. In 1974 she married Tom Lunn. Edith' s interest in the history of Bendigo resulted in her being awarded the Order of Australia in 2002. She died in 2009.Bendigo Advertiser from Saturday, January 26, 2002. His book, Λαογραφικα 'Ανἁλεκτα της Ιθἁκης', written in Greek, documents Ithacan cultural and folkloric heritage. The launch was held at Ithaca House in Elizabeth Street, Melbourne. Andreas was born in Ithaca and migrated to Australia in 1957 to join his brothers Hector and George Anagnostatos (Andrews). He eventually retired in Ithaca where he wrote and published several books about Ithaca.
